
Ordinal Numbers in English – Rules, List, Usage & Examples
Even though 11th, 12th, and 13th end in 1, 2, and 3, they still take “th” because of their special spelling and pronunciation: 11th, 12th, 13th (not 11st, 12nd, or 13rd)
